Sainsbury's Extra Strong Red Label Tea offers a robust blend of Kenyan and other full-bodied black teas, delivering a brisk and invigorating experience. With 80 bags in a 250g package, this fairly traded tea has been exclusively blended by J. Sainsbury since 1903, ensuring quality and tradition in every cup.
